Emungalan demographics (2021 Census)

The figures below profile Emungalan using the Australian Bureau of Statistics 2021 Census; every percentage is a share of a clearly stated Census count, so each one traces back to the source. At a glance, the largest age group is mid-life (45–64) at 33%, 75% of homes are rented, and 4% of residents were born overseas.

Is Emungalan an advantaged area?

Emungalan has an ABS SEIFA score of 798, where about 1000 is the national average — higher scores indicate greater relative socio-economic advantage. That gives it a Suburb Score of 2 out of 100 — more socio-economically advantaged than about 2% of Australian suburbs.
